Reflection for Today

Let Hebrews 6:6 speak first, before our plans and worries do: “And are fallen away: to be renewed again to penance, crucifying again to themselves the Son of God and making him a mockery.”

Scripture rarely flatters us. It loves us enough to tell the truth, and then it stays with us while we learn to live that truth. Hebrews comes from the apostolic age, when the first communities were learning how to live the Gospel in ordinary struggles. The Church still listens here for guidance.

Today's invitation under the theme of Daily Scripture is simple and serious. Share this verse with someone who needs encouragement, not as advice from above, but as a gift you yourself are trying to live.
